Part number is FA516060. Mercury shows the part is no longer availible. You could try doug russell.com. They show the same part number but twice the cost. Parts for smaller chryslers have totally disappeared. I am suprised you were able to find a new impeller for it. If you dont have any luck try Twincityoutboard or chryslercrew.com. Yes the impeller is the part of the water pump that most often need replacing.

I tried a few sources, and all listed it as no longer available.
Keep looking, you might get lucky.
You may need to buy a water pump kit, or a complete water pump, to get the impeller.
